BRANT COUNTY - Beginning in August of next year, new water meters will be installed in Paris.
Neptune Technology will be in charge of installing them and they'll continue into 2020.
The installations will be happening on an area by area basis within the community. As technicians move into the area, homeowners will receive notice from Brant County and Neptune prompting them to schedule an appointment, along with a brochure.
The brochure includes a reference number to call and book your appointment. The County wants to thank residents for their cooperation.
The County says if you receive a door hanger prompting you to make an appointment, technicians are in your area.
If you have not received the brochure or the door hanger prompting you to book your appointment, it means technicians are not in your area yet.
